Transitional Kindergarten Assistant (TKA)

Assist teacher, at an assigned center or site, with related instructional activities designed to stimulate learning. Support the teacher in the care and supervision of students. About the vacancy

Location:

Various Hours/Day: 6 hours/day Days/Week: 5 days/week Months/Year: 9 months/year Employees in this position work 6 hours per day, 5 days per week, 9 months per year and shall qualify for district contributed health insurance, sick days, paid time off and membership to CalPERS for retirement benefits.

Requirements / Qualifications

Minimum qualifications and special license or language skills

Experience:

Six (6) months field work with preschool and/or elementary school aged children.

Education:

Associates degree or above from an accredited college/university – OR – Awarded high school diploma or GED equivalent PLUS transcript showing completion of 48 semester units from an accredited college. Units in early childhood education preferred. Immunization requirements:
Proof of immunization against influenza, pertussis, and measles is required. Refer to California Code, Health and Safety Code - HSC §
